Webcam dos Acer Aspire 5600 Series no Ubuntu Linux 17/08/07

Os notebooks Aspire da Acer vem com uma webcam integrada acima da tela. Essa webcam pode ser da Logitech, Orbit ou uma marca desconhecida que dizem se chamar Bison. Bison mesmo eu só conheço o ‘chefão’ do Street Fighter mas esse é assunto do meu outro blog.

Como essa webcam Bison não funciona out of the box no Ubuntu esse artigo tem como objetivo descrever os passos para você deixa-la operacional. Tudo que esta escrito aqui foi testado com sucesso num Aspire 5630 com Ubuntu 7.04.

Primeiro vamos identificar se realmente temos uma webcam Bison no notebook, depois baixar e compilar os fontes do driver, carregar o modulo e por fim testar em alguma aplicação. Simples, rápido e indolor.

Para identificar a webcam basta executar o lsusb no console e procurar por uma linha com ID 5986:0100 ou ID 5986:0200.

Para baixar o código fonte direto do repositório é preciso ter o Subversion instalado e executar:

svn checkout svn://svn.berlios.de/linux-uvc/linux-uvc/trunk

Se você não tem e nem deseja instalar o Subversion basta copiar para alguma pastas todos os arquivos do site: http://svn.berlios.de/svnroot/repos/linux-uvc/linux-uvc/trunk.

No Ubuntu é necessário fazer uma pequena alteração no arquivo Makefile substituindo a linha INSTALL_MOD_DIR := usb/media para INSTALL_MOD_DIR := kernel/ubuntu/media/usbvideo.

Agora basta a sequência de comandos abaixo para compilar e carregar o módulo do driver.


cd [diretorio dos arquivos]
sudo make
sudo modprobe -r uvcvideo
sudo make install
sudo modprobe uvcvideo

Para testar basta abrir qualquer programa que faça uso do dispositivo. No meu caso testei a funcionalidade da webcam com o luvcview que é recomendado pela equipe que mantém o driver. Para instalar o luvcview:

wget http://mxhaard.free.fr/spca50x/Investigation/uvc/luvcview-20070512.tar.gz
tar -xzvf luvcview-20070512.tar.gz
cd luvcview-20070512
make
./luvcview

Se tudo aconteceu sem problemas uma janela com um live preview da webcam salta na sua tela. Para compilar o luvcview é necessário ter as bibliotecas de desenvolvimento do SDL, caso não tenha instale com o comando sudo apt-get install libsdl1.2-dev.

Qualquer dúvida deixe um comentário que eu tenho ajudar.

Linux 8 Comentários Ella Fitzgerald – Time Alone Will Tell


8 comentários

Opa, sabe de alguma novidade a respeito do driver?
eu estou testanqui aqui no note, e sim, aparece pelo luvcview, e quando giro a camera ele inverte automaticamente a imagem, mas ela me parece um pouco inferior do que a que consigo no windows e não consegui fazer funcionar em nenhum outro programa, por exemplo no ekigua ele nao abre de jeito nenhum… com o Cheese (vide getdeb) também ele diz que não tenho webcam… ainda não testei no Amsn… mas você teve algum sucesso em utilizar a webcam ou tem alguma outra dica pra passar?

Abração e obrigado por compartilhar a informação :)

olá, eu jah instalei o luvcview só q ficou dentro da minha pasta pessoal dentro da /home. como eu faço pra executar o programa?

Então.. tenho um acer 5570,
Segui tudo direitinho..
mas não funcionou..
testei com o camorama, mas é exibida a mensagem que não é possivel conectar com o dispositivo (/dev/video0)
Se tiver mais algo que eu possa fazer!
Valeu

os arquivos nao estao no endereco especificado, por favor coloca no rapidshare
se der, atualiza o tutorial para o ubuntu 7.10

VALEU VINICIUS!!! otimo, f uncionou mesmo, apesar que eu axei que fica com qualidade bem inferior do que no ruindows
obrigado!!

Excelente orientação, quase cheguei lá, mas ocorreu um erro quando tentei executar o luvcview:
./luvcview
luvcview version 0.2.1
Video driver: x11
A window manager is available
video /dev/video0
Unable to set format: 16.
Init v4L2 failed !! exit fatal

Alguém pode ajudar? Obrigado.

o meu deu o msm o erro do de cima ai!

[...] -Camera É o problema que estou tratando atualmente. Para identificar a webcam basta executar o lsusb no console e procurar por uma linha com ID 5986:0100 ou ID 5986:0200. O trecho abaixo foi copiado de um blog que achei pesquisando na net. Para ler na integra todas as informações clique aqui. [...]

Comente, participe!




Comentário